Residents sound the alarm as drought threatens water supply for third year in a row: 'There's a feeling of almost helplessness'

Summary by thecooldown.com
A historic drought in the Mississippi River Valley is a crucial factor putting thousands of people in southeast Louisiana on edge as officials seek a solution to their water supply woes.  What's happening? As detailed by the Mississippi Free Press, saltwater from the Gulf of Mexico has intermixed with freshwater from the Mississippi River for the third year in a row, threatening the water supply for cities as far as 100 miles from the river's so…
